Cost of independent living in Perinton, NY

The average cost of senior living in Perinton is $3,085 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Fairport, NY with an average of $3,085 per month.

Independent living costs in Perinton, NY, vs. state and national averages

Perinton, NY
$3,085/mo
U.S. national average
$3,520/mo

Independent living costs in Perinton, NY, vs. other senior living options

$7,371/mo
Independent Living
$3,085/mo

Independent living costs in Perinton, NY, by floor plan type

Studio
$2,916/mo
1 Bedroom
$3,561/mo
2 Bedroom
$4,620/mo

Senior living costs in Perinton vs. state and national costs

Cost comparison table showing community type cost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column communityType: Community type
Column destination: Perinton, NY
Column state: New York
Column national: U.S.
Community typePerinton, NYNew YorkU.S.
Independent Living$3,085/mo$3,974/mo$3,520/mo
Assisted Living$5,183/mo$6,817/mo$5,830/mo
Memory Care$7,371/mo$8,640/mo$6,999/mo
Independent Living
Perinton, NY:$3,085/mo
New York:$3,974/mo
U.S.:$3,520/mo
Assisted Living
Perinton, NY:$5,183/mo
New York:$6,817/mo
U.S.:$5,830/mo
Memory Care
Perinton, NY:$7,371/mo
New York:$8,640/mo
U.S.:$6,999/mo

Independent living cost trends in Perinton, NY

The table below shows how monthly independent living costs in Perinton have changed in the last two years and how those changes compare with state and national trends. The figures represent averages of actual costs paid by seniors who moved into A Place for Mom partner communities in 2023 and 2024.

Cost comparison table showing 2023 and 2024 average cost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column location: Location
Column cost2024: 2024 average cost
Column cost2023: 2023 average cost
Column percentChange: Percent change
Location2024 average cost2023 average costPercent change
Perinton, NY$3,092/mo$3,175/mo-2.6%
New York$3,681/mo$3,675/mo+0.1%
National$3,416/mo$3,319/mo+2.9%
Perinton, NY
2024 average cost:$3,092/mo
2023 average cost:$3,175/mo
Percent change:-2.6%
New York
2024 average cost:$3,681/mo
2023 average cost:$3,675/mo
Percent change:+0.1%
National
2024 average cost:$3,416/mo
2023 average cost:$3,319/mo
Percent change:+2.9%
